How Matarecycler Works in Practice
Matarecycler employs a structured approach to handle waste effectively, starting from collection to processing and repurposing. Waste is carefully sorted into categories, ensuring recyclable materials are separated from organic or hazardous items. This initial step is crucial because it determines the efficiency of the subsequent recycling and repurposing stages, ultimately affecting environmental outcomes.
Once sorted, materials undergo specialized processing techniques. Plastics, metals, paper, and glass each follow tailored procedures to maximize their usability. For instance, plastics might be shredded and melted into raw material for new products, while metals are purified and recast. This step ensures the recycled output meets quality standards suitable for industrial and consumer use.
Finally, Matarecycler connects these materials to industries or businesses that can repurpose them. By creating a reliable supply chain for recycled resources, it reduces the need for virgin materials. This model supports the circular economy concept, helping both companies and communities reduce costs while promoting sustainable production practices that align with modern environmental priorities.
Environmental Benefits of Using Matarecycler
One of the most significant advantages of Matarecycler is its environmental impact. By diverting waste from landfills, it reduces soil and water contamination while lowering the burden on municipal waste systems. Fewer landfills mean reduced methane emissions and a smaller carbon footprint, which is critical in combating climate change. The system’s focus on material recovery further preserves natural resources.
Matarecycler also helps conserve energy. Recycling materials often consumes less energy compared to producing goods from raw resources. For example, remelting aluminum saves up to 95% of the energy required to extract it from ore. By facilitating such energy-efficient processes, Matarecycler contributes to broader sustainability efforts while supporting businesses in achieving their green targets.
Another environmental benefit is reduced pollution from manufacturing. When materials are reused, there’s less need for industrial extraction, refining, and production. This reduces air and water pollutants, improving overall environmental health. Matarecycler’s approach encourages responsible consumption, ensuring that the ecological footprint of products is minimized without compromising on functionality or quality.

Technology Behind Matarecycler
Matarecycler relies on advanced technology to streamline recycling and material recovery. Automated sorting machines use sensors and AI to identify different types of waste with precision. This reduces human error, speeds up processing, and ensures materials maintain high quality for reuse. By integrating technology, Matarecycler makes large-scale recycling both feasible and efficient.
Processing technologies are equally important. Specialized machinery cleans, refines, and reshapes materials to meet industry standards. For example, plastics are melted into pellets, metals are purified, and paper fibers are processed into new sheets. These methods allow materials to be recycled multiple times without significant degradation, which is a key factor in achieving sustainable circular economies.
Data management also plays a role in Matarecycler’s efficiency. Tracking waste sources, volumes, and processing outcomes allows operators to optimize logistics and reduce bottlenecks. Digital platforms facilitate communication with businesses that consume recycled materials, ensuring that supply meets demand efficiently and responsibly, minimizing waste at every stage.
Practical Tips for Using Matarecycler at Home or Business
Adopting Matarecycler practices starts with proper waste segregation. Households can separate plastics, metals, glass, and paper before collection, making recycling more effective. Businesses can implement similar systems, ensuring that production scraps or office waste are sorted efficiently to feed into the recycling process.
Education is also crucial. Understanding which materials are recyclable, and how to prepare them, improves results. For instance, rinsing containers, removing non-recyclable parts, and compacting waste can increase efficiency and reduce contamination. Simple habits like these have a big impact on overall recycling outcomes.
Engagement with local programs strengthens the effort further. Joining community initiatives, signing up for pick-up services, or collaborating with recycling centers ensures that materials processed through Matarecycler reach their intended destinations. Consistent participation encourages sustainability and demonstrates personal and corporate responsibility in protecting the environment.
